About This Trial
G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D) is a common gastrointestinal disorder, with around 80% of patients experiencing nighttime symptoms. The prolonged nighttime reflux increases esophageal acid exposure, leading to complications like erosive esophagitis and extra-esophageal symptoms such as asthma and chronic cough.
